Privacy & Security Architecture
Encryption
End-to-end encryption for patient data in transit and at rest.
Access Controls
Role-based access, authentication, and authorization.
Audit Logging
Complete audit trails for all access to patient information.
Data Minimization
Collect and store only necessary patient information.
Compliance Coordination
Work with your legal and compliance advisors on regulatory requirements.
Incident Response
Documented procedures for data breach response and notification.

Frequently Asked Questions
What security features do healthcare applications need?▼
Encryption, access controls, audit logging, data minimization, secure vendor relationships, and incident response procedures are essential. Requirements vary by organization and should be confirmed with your compliance and legal advisors.
Can existing healthcare websites be updated for better security?▼
Often yes, but significant changes may be needed. We assess existing systems and recommend practical improvements based on your requirements.
What should I know about vendor compliance?▼
Any vendors handling patient information should have appropriate data agreements and security practices. We recommend working with your legal team to establish proper vendor requirements.
How do I ensure my healthcare application is compliant?▼
Work with your legal, compliance, and security advisors to define requirements. We build systems that support those requirements, but regulatory compliance is a shared responsibility.
What about cloud hosting and HIPAA?▼
Yes, cloud hosting can be HIPAA-compliant. The hosting provider must sign a BAA and implement required security measures.
